File xrdp-CVE-2022-23480.patch of Package xrdp.29800

From 6f31db348357b3510e88c6d8b18cba1ae6348d88 Mon Sep 17 00:00:00 2001
From: matt335672 <30179339+matt335672@users.noreply.github.com>
Date: Tue, 6 Dec 2022 12:48:57 +0000
Subject: [PATCH 05/10] CVE-2022-23480

Added length checking to redirector response parsing
---
 sesman/chansrv/devredir.c | 285 +++++++++++++++++++++++++-------------
 1 file changed, 188 insertions(+), 97 deletions(-)
